US Consular Officers in Vietnam: probably the most stress-free task on this planet!
On June 4, 2025, President Donald Trump—his “Make The usa good all over again” slogan nevertheless echoing in the background—signed a tough government get barring citizens from twelve international locations from environment foot on U.S. soil. The reason? Their visa overstay prices were being just f